Kinds Of Volvo Keys
Before diving into the replacement procedure, it's essential to comprehend the various kinds of keys that Volvo uses. Here's a table summing up each type:
Type of Key
Description
Typical Use
Conventional Key
A standard metal key used in older models, without any advanced electronics.
Older Volvo designs
Transponder Key
A key that consists of a microchip that interacts with the car's ignition system for improved security.
Models from the early 2000s onwards
Keyless Entry Remote
A remote device that permits for keyless entry and frequently consists of ignition abilities as well.
Common in modern-day Volvo models
Smart Key/Fob
A modern key that permits keyless ignition and entry, typically featuring a push-button start.
Most current Volvo designs
Replacement Process
When you require a replacement key for your Volvo, the procedure will differ depending upon the kind of key you have. Below are standards for each key type.
1. Standard Key Replacement
- Where to Obtain: Local locksmith or Volvo dealer.
- Cost: Generally low— around ₤ 10 to ₤ 50.
- Process:
- Provide the initial key or the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) to the locksmith.
- Receive the new key.
2. Transponder Key Replacement
- Where to Obtain: Volvo dealer, accredited locksmith, or authorized service centers.
- Cost: Typically ranges from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150.
- Process:
- Visit a dealership or qualified service center with your VIN.
- The technician will set the key to match your car's ignition system.
3. Keyless Entry Remote Replacement
- Where to Obtain: Volvo dealership or online vendors.
- Cost: Usually between ₤ 100 and ₤ 300.
- Process:
- Purchase the remote either online or from a dealership.
- Program the remote using the car's onboard programming methods or by means of a technician.
4. Smart Key/Fob Replacement
- Where to Obtain: Authorized Volvo car dealerships only.
- Cost: Can be as high as ₤ 300 to ₤ 600.
- Process:
- Bring the needed paperwork (ownership evidence, identification).
- The car dealership will set the smart key and guarantee it syncs with your automobile's system.

Frequently asked question Section
1. Can I get a replacement key without the original?
It's possible, however you will require your car's VIN and proof of ownership to get a replacement from a dealer or certified locksmith.
2. For how long does it require to get a replacement key?
The time needed varies; a standard key might be prepared in minutes, whereas clever keys can take longer due to programming and specialization.
